Terry, as you have no doubt discovered in your research, the CSR of all the troops of the Trans-Mississippi Department are woefully inadequate -- with Missouri probably being the worst. The copyists had relatively little to work with. They had virtually no muster rolls to work from dating after February 1864, nor did they have much in the way of casualty lists, hospital registers, etc. The primary reason, of course, is that Federal control of the Mississippi River made it difficult for the TMD to send reports back to Richmond. There are some modern-day researchers who have access to more TMD records than the War Department copyists had.

For that reason, the work that researchers like you are doing is critically important.
